Fiskars PowerGear Hedge Shears
Best heavy-duty shears for gardeners needing extra cutting power.
Effortlessly maintain your hedges with the Fiskars PowerGear Hedge Shears. Engineered with patented PowerGear® technology, these shears amplify your cutting power up to three times, making light work of dense branches. The precision-ground, fully hardened steel blades ensure lasting sharpness and cut cleanly to the tip. Enjoy smooth operation thanks to a low-friction coating that resists sap and rust. Designed for comfort during extended use, they feature shock-absorbing bumpers and lightweight aluminum construction for easy handling and durability.

Key Specs
Blade Material
Precision-ground steel
Blade Length
10 inches (254 mm)
Overall Length
23 inches (584.2 mm)
Handle Material
Aluminum
Blade Coating
Low-friction coating
Cutting Mechanism Type
Bypass
Rust Resistant
Yes
Power Source Type
Manual

Know before you buy
PowerGear technology uses a specialized gear mechanism to multiply your cutting force. This allows you to cut through thicker, denser branches with significantly less physical effort compared to standard hedge shears.
These shears are specifically engineered for tougher branches. Thanks to the gear-assisted cutting power and the 10-inch hardened steel blades, they are well-suited for more demanding pruning tasks beyond simple leaf trimming.
No, they are designed with lightweight aluminum handles to minimize fatigue. Additionally, the integrated shock-absorbing bumpers help reduce the jarring impact on your arms and wrists during extended pruning sessions.
The blades feature a low-friction coating that is specifically designed to resist both sap buildup and rust. While they are highly durable, it is still good practice to wipe them clean after use to ensure the blades remain sharp and smooth.
